Q: Is 50,676 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 50,676 is a composite number.

Why is 50,676 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 50,676 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 41 82 103 123 164 206 246 309 412 492 618 1,236 4,223 8,446 12,669 16,892 25,338 and 50,676, with no remainder.

Since 50,676 cannot be divided by just 1 and 50,676, it is a composite number.
